What is  QR Code?

 

The QR Code is a form of barcode that consists of black and white pixels arranged in two dimensions. Its origin can be traced back to Denso Wave, which is an affiliated company of Toyota's supplier Denso. It was initially designed for the purpose of marking components as this would improve their automobile production’s logistics process efficiency.

Today, it has become increasingly popular within mobile marketing due to its compatibility with smartphones being widely adopted globally. One significant aspect worth noting is that "QR" stands for "Quick Response", referring to quick access available through scanning codes giving instant accessibility global information stored on the code itself by business owners or marketers alike ultimately benefiting providers and consumers altogether.

 

Key Characteristics of QR Codes:

  • Structure: QR codes consist of black squares arranged in a square grid on a white background. They can be read by a camera and processed to extract the data encoded within.
  • Encoding: QR codes can store various types of data, such as text, URL links, contact information, Wi-Fi credentials, and more.
  • Error Correction: QR codes have built-in error correction capabilities, allowing them to be read even if they are partially damaged or obscured.

Uses of QR Codes:

  • Marketing and Advertising: Businesses use QR codes to provide customers with quick access to websites, promotional materials, or product information.
  • Contactless Transactions: QR codes facilitate contactless payments, ticketing, and check-ins.
  • Product Tracking: QR codes are used in supply chain management to track products and manage inventory.
  • Authentication: QR codes are employed in secure authentication systems for logging into accounts or accessing services.
  • Informational Kiosks: Museums, galleries, and public spaces use QR codes to provide additional information about exhibits and displays.
  • Personal Use: Individuals can use QR codes to share contact details, social media profiles, or Wi-Fi network credentials.

How QR Codes Work:

  • Creation: A QR code generator creates the QR code by encoding the input data into a pattern of black and white squares.
  • Scanning: A QR code reader (usually a smartphone camera with a QR code scanning app) scans the QR code.
  • Decoding: The QR code reader interprets the pattern and extracts the encoded information.
  • Action: Based on the decoded data, the device performs an action, such as opening a web page, saving contact information, or connecting to a Wi-Fi network.

Advantages of QR Codes:

  • Versatility: QR codes can store a wide range of data types.
  • Speed: Quick and easy to scan and retrieve information.
  • Error Correction: Can be read even if part of the code is damaged.
  • Cost-Effective: Inexpensive to generate and print.
